Specs for the ATI 32 MB Rage Pro 128 AGP

104 42

    Designation

    • The ATI 32 MB Rage Pro 128 AGP fits into the Accelerated Graphics Port of a desktop personal computer, thus the "AGP" suffix. It is particularly compatible with an AGP that provides a transfer rate of up 1,066 MB per second and a 1.5-V operational voltage. The "32 MB" designation stands for the amount of built-in memory it has for its video capabilities, which are based on Synchronous Dynamic Random Access Memory architecture. The number "128" stands for 128 bits, which is the size of the collection of wires through which the card transmits data.

    Video Output and RAMDAC

    • Each ATI 32 MB Rage Pro 128 AGP has a 15-pin Video Graphics Array (VGA) connector, which provided the interface to hook up the computer monitor for an analog visual display. Besides the VGA output, the card provides an S-Video output and an RCA video connector. Also included is a Random Access Memory Digital-to-Analog Converter, or RAMDAC, for processing the color display of the monitor, which it performs at a 300 MHz rate.

    Resolutions

    • The highest graphics display resolution that the ATI 32 MB Rage Pro 128 AGP supports is the Widescreen Ultra eXtended Graphics Array's 1,920-by-1,200 pixels at an 85 Hz frequency and with a 16.7-million color display in 24-bit depth. Other resolutions that the card supports include VGA's 640-by-480 pixels and the 800-by-600-pixel standard of its more advanced Super VGA sibling; and Super eXtended Graphics Array's 1,280-by-1,024 pixels and Ultra eXtended Graphics Array's 1,600 by 1,200, which fall under the same extended graphics array umbrella as the WUXGA.

    System Requirements

    • Besides the AGP port, the desktop PC that the ATI 32 MB Rage Pro 128 AGP goes into must at least run Microsoft's Windows 98, 2000 or Millennium Edition operating system. It must also have at least an Intel Pentium III microprocessor.
